Biography: The Early Years of John Mayer

John Mayer's journey to stardom began in Bridgeport, Connecticut, where he was born on October 16, 1977. Growing up in a family that valued music, Mayer was introduced to the guitar at the age of 13. His early influences included blues legends like Stevie Ray Vaughan and B.B. King, which shaped his musical style. After honing his skills in local coffeehouses, Mayer attended the prestigious Berklee College of Music in Boston. However, he soon realized that his true calling lay in performing live, leading him to drop out and pursue a career in music. Mayer's big break came in 2001 with the release of his debut album, *Room for Squares*. The album's success catapulted him into the limelight, earning him critical acclaim and a loyal fan base. Over the years, Mayer has released multiple chart-topping albums, each showcasing his growth as an artist. His ability to blend genres and experiment with new sounds has kept his music fresh and relevant. Beyond his artistic achievements, Mayer is also known for his candid interviews and thought-provoking lyrics, which often reflect his personal experiences.

    What Are Some of John Mayer's Signature Guitar Techniques?

    Among Mayer's signature techniques is his use of the pentatonic scale, which he employs to create melodic solos. He also frequently uses double stops, a technique that involves playing two notes simultaneously, to add richness to his sound. Another hallmark of his style is his ability to seamlessly transition between rhythm and lead guitar, a skill that few artists possess.

    Collaborations That Defined John Mayer's Career

    John Mayer's collaborations have played a pivotal role in shaping his career. One of his most notable partnerships was with Eric Clapton, a blues legend who has long been one of Mayer's idols. Their collaboration on the album *The Breeze: An Appreciation of JJ Cale* allowed Mayer to pay homage to one of his musical heroes while showcasing his own talents. The project earned critical acclaim and further solidified Mayer's status as a blues virtuoso.

    John Mayer's Contributions to Philanthropy and Social Causes

    Beyond his music, John Mayer is known for his philanthropic efforts and commitment to social causes. One of his most notable contributions is the Back to You Fund, which he established in 2004. The fund supports various charitable organizations, with a focus on education, healthcare, and the arts. Mayer has also been a vocal advocate for mental health awareness, often using his platform to encourage open conversations about the subject.

    In addition to his charitable work, Mayer has participated in numerous benefit concerts and campaigns. His involvement in events like the Stand Up to Cancer telethon and the Bridge School Benefit has helped raise millions for important causes. Mayer's dedication to giving back demonstrates his commitment to using his success for the greater good.
